fits model: Mx, Zx, Lc, 440, Trail. make: Skidoo, Ski-doo. year: 1999–2007.

( Brand: Ski-doo ), ( Manufacturer Part Number: 420923870 ), ( Part Type: Cylinder Head )
The Ski-Doo 420923870 Trail Cylinder Head Dome is a crucial component designed specifically for the 1999-2007 MX ZX 440 LC snowmobiles. This part is responsible for housing the combustion chamber and the spark plug inside the cylinder head.
